An unforgettable visit

Benidorm is a beautiful town with its beaches and spectacular skyscrapers, but you can also have fun visiting the theme parks. One of them is Terra Natura, a paradise for animal lovers. The park is divided into four sections: Pangaea, Europe, Asia and America.

It’s an interesting park because you hardly feel like there are barriers between you and the animals. Some barriers are simply (reinforced) glass, and the feeling of seeing the animals just one meter away from you is pretty interesting. You ask yourself, but what if they wake up? Is the glass really strong enough? These barriers make this park so special.

Fun-filled day

In this zoo, the barriers between the animals and the visitors are minimal. There are 320,000 square meters divided into Pangea, America, Asia, and Europe. You can see the bird of prey fly and the big fish swim and enjoy shows like the elephant feeding as well as learn how to take care of the animals. On the weekends, you can try the ripcord which drops you down at 50 km/hour around the elephant grassland. You can hear the screams of excitement throughout the park.

For kids and adults alike

Excellent

We were there and came home thrilled. In addition to seeing all of the animals, the Pocahontas show is very entertaining, as eagles, vultures, and other birds of prey flew over our heads. The area is enormous and a tour takes 4 hours. Make sure to bring something to drink and a sandwich, although there are also restaurants in the park. We’ll definitely be going back.
